Sprinkler systems offer a reliable method for irrigating lawns and gardens. By distributing water evenly across a wide area , these systems help to ensure plant growth while reducing water waste. With various sprinkler types available, homeowners can select the ideal system for their individual circumstances.
Properly designed and installed sprinkler systems result in healthier plants and a thriving landscape. They also simplify the irrigation process, freeing up your time for other tasks. Additionally, sprinkler systems can be controlled for optimal water delivery . This programming helps to conserve water resources .
To ensure maximum performance and productivity, sprinkler systems need consistent maintenance. This includes inspecting nozzles for blockage , adjusting watering schedules based on weather conditions , and addressing any problems promptly.

Sustain Your Irrigation Sprinklers in Tip-Top Shape
To ensure the longevity of your irrigation sprinklers, regular maintenance is key. Begin by examining your sprinkler system at least once a month for any indications of damage or leaks. Completely clean the sprinkler heads with a broom to remove debris and mineral buildup. Think about using a mild cleaning solution if necessary. Confirm that all sprinkler heads are directed correctly to provide water evenly across your lawn.
- Examine the pressure regulator occasionally to preserve optimal water pressure.
- Empty your sprinkler system in the fall to prevent freeze damage during winter months.
- Refer a professional irrigation specialist for any repairs or maintenance tasks you are uncomfortable to handle yourself.
